Вернуться   Форум SAPE.RU > Общие вопросы > Разработка и сопровождение сайтов

-->
Ответ
 
Опции темы
Старый 12.12.2008, 13:16   #101
Мафиози
 
Аватар для Русская мафия
 
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 243
Русская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ущее
По умолчанию

Цитата:
Сообщение от gobliin Посмотреть сообщение
ещё было бы корректнее сплитить по (\n|\n\r|\r ) кажется так. если не понятно могу разъяснить почему.
Разъясните если можно
__________________
Как дела?
Русская мафия вне форума   Ответить с цитированием
Старый 12.12.2008, 19:07   #102
Специалист
 
Аватар для gobliin
 
Регистрация: 07.05.2008
Адрес: Н-ск
Сообщений: 254
Вес репутации: 209
gob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личностьgobliin - просто великолепная личность
Отправить сообщение для gobliin с помощью ICQ
По умолчанию

\'\\n\' - #10
\'\\r\' - #13
перенос на новую строку может быть как \n так и \n\r
я когда файлики парсил с этим сталкивался, и не уверен что в textarea все браузеры перенос строки как \n делают, некоторые могут как \n\r делать. как-то так.
gobliin вне форума   Ответить с цитированием
Старый 12.12.2008, 19:57   #103
Мафиози
 
Аватар для Русская мафия
 
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 243
Русская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ущее
По умолчанию

gobliin, Хм, спасибо, озадачили )))
__________________
Как дела?
Русская мафия вне форума   Ответить с цитированием
Старый 12.12.2008, 20:17   #104
Мастер
 
Аватар для Hanapi
 
Регистрация: 05.06.2008
Адрес: Somali
Сообщений: 648
Вес репутации: 232
Han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ущееHanapi - прекрасное будущее
По умолчанию

Цитата:
Сообщение от gobliin Посмотреть сообщение
браузеры перенос строки как \n делают, некоторые могут как \n\r делать
это не изменит функционала написанного мною выше, r\n - это если пхп под винду.. если уж изголяться, то и \r для маков тоже надо предусмотреть
__________________
хостинг с root доступом
помог? отблагодари!

Последний раз редактировалось Hanapi; 12.12.2008 в 20:18. Причина: Добавлено сообщение
Hanapi вне форума   Ответить с цитированием
Старый 12.12.2008, 21:07   #105
Мафиози
 
Аватар для Русская мафия
 
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 243
Русская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ущее
По умолчанию

А когда в исходном коде выводится код с новой строки, это что значит? Т.е. выводиться так:
PHP код:
Код
Код 
а должно так:
PHP код:
КодКод 
Это в самом коде HTML страницы. Уже час не могу убрать, уже что только не пробывал.
Преобразовывал строку ф-ей nl2br( ), в коде появлялось - <br />, но после этого всё равно начинается новая строка.
После этих преобразований я вырезал <br /> так:
$text[$i]=str_replace('<br />','',$text[$i]);

<br /> убиралось из кода, но новая строка оставалась, а из-за этой новой строки в коде, на сайте стоит пробел.
Как можно вылечить?

Добавлено через 9 минут
До этого я получил вот так массив:
$text = explode("\n", $_POST['text1']);
из textarea
__________________
Как дела?

Последний раз редактировалось Русская мафия; 12.12.2008 в 21:07. Причина: Добавлено сообщение
Русская мафия вне форума   Ответить с цитированием
Старый 12.12.2008, 21:52   #106
Мастер
 
Аватар для DNA
 
Регистрация: 23.09.2008
Адрес: СССР
Сообщений: 683
Вес репутации: 228
DN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ущее
Отправить сообщение для DNA с помощью ICQ
По умолчанию

Цитата:
Сообщение от Русская мафия Посмотреть сообщение
...
$text[$i] = str_replace("\r",'',$text[$i]);

Попробуйте этим заменить nl2br.
DNA вне форума   Ответить с цитированием
Старый 12.12.2008, 22:15   #107
Мафиози
 
Аватар для Русская мафия
 
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 243
Русская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ущее
По умолчанию

DNA, Заработало! Спасибо!
__________________
Как дела?
Русская мафия вне форума   Ответить с цитированием
Старый 12.12.2008, 22:19   #108
Дикий
 
Аватар для D.iK.iJ
 
Регистрация: 02.06.2007
Адрес: <Noindex>
Сообщений: 2,551
Вес репутации: 355
D.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ущееD.iK.iJ - прекрасное будущее
Smile

Тоже иногда развлекаюсь со скриптами, пока учу PHP
Всякая подобная ерунда получается:
http://dikij.com/scripts/

Зато работает как-то
Цитата:
D.iK.iJ - запись IP © версия 1.1 [И] [С] (архив 5,4 КБ) - скрипт записывает IP адреса посетителей за день и выводит их в отдельном файле (самый простой сниффер). Данные недельной давности удаляются автоматически.
Давно уж ничего не обновлял. Всепоследние "разработки" напрямик ушли в движок сайта
D.iK.iJ вне форума   Ответить с цитированием
Старый 12.12.2008, 22:55   #109
Мафиози
 
Аватар для Русская мафия
 
Регистрация: 11.09.2008
Адрес: <H1></H1>
Сообщений: 1,174
Вес репутации: 243
Русская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ущееРусская мафия - прекрасное будущее
По умолчанию

А как проверить правильная ссылка или нет?
Пробывал file_exists($adres) - не получается, говорит что нету такого, хотя он есть.
Хотя этот метод наверно не верен на 100%, есть идеи как сделать по другому?

Добавлено через 2 минуты
D.iK.iJ, У меня сейчас есть несколько задумак, масштабных, как раз покроют больше половины курса php и MYSQL Ну или покрайней мере базовую часть. Кстати одно я уже можно считать закончил, осталось удалить все возможные ошибки, скоро выложу
__________________
Как дела?

Последний раз редактировалось Русская мафия; 12.12.2008 в 22:55. Причина: Добавлено сообщение
Русская мафия вне форума   Ответить с цитированием
Старый 13.12.2008, 10:45   #110
Мастер
 
Аватар для DNA
 
Регистрация: 23.09.2008
Адрес: СССР
Сообщений: 683
Вес репутации: 228
DN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ущееDNA - прекрасное будущее
Отправить сообщение для DNA с помощью ICQ
По умолчанию

Цитата:
Сообщение от Русская мафия Посмотреть сообщение
А как проверить правильная ссылка или нет?
Пробывал file_exists($adres) - не получается, говорит что нету такого, хотя он есть.
file_get_contents($url)

Добавлено через 17 минут
Цитата:
Сообщение от DNA Посмотреть сообщение
file_get_contents($url)
Но вобще это бред конечно Но фпринципе работает

Последний раз редактировалось DNA; 13.12.2008 в 10:45. Причина: Добавлено сообщение
DNA вне форума   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Ещё вопросы по ИП от ВМ Turbo Финансовые и юридические вопросы 1 14.10.2008 12:00
Вопросы borodun Вопросы от новичков 5 11.06.2008 17:56
Вопросы.. TooL Вопросы по работе системы 3 13.04.2008 16:49
1ps - вопросы Anatoly Курилка 7 13.07.2007 13:57
Вопросы paf Вопросы по работе системы 13 14.05.2007 15:23


Часовой пояс GMT +3, время: 14:26.